Things to do in Bulacan

Shopping

In Bulacan, visit the bustling SM City Baliwag, where you'll find a variety of shops offering clothing, electronics, and local crafts. Alternatively, explore the vibrant Bulacan Public Market for fresh produce, traditional snacks, and unique souvenirs that reflect the local culture.

Recreation

In Bulacan, indulge in holistic wellness at The Farm at San Benito, where you can enjoy organic meals and rejuvenating spa therapies amidst lush landscapes. Alternatively, visit the tranquil Aloha Wellness Spa, offering soothing massages and wellness treatments designed to revitalise the mind and body.

Adventure

In Bulacan, explore the scenic trails of Mount Balagbag, ideal for hiking enthusiasts seeking stunning views. Experience thrill-seeking at the San Rafael River Adventure Park, where you can enjoy kayaking and zip-lining amidst lush landscapes. Visit the historic Barasoain Church for a blend of culture and adventure.

Nightlife

Explore the vibrant nightlife in Bulacan with a visit to the lively Bar 101, where you can enjoy a variety of cocktails and local beers. For a taste of live music, check out the bustling Salo-Salo, where you can unwind with friends and soak in the local atmosphere.

Find the best attractions in Bulacan

Bulacan offers an ideal destination for family, city, and business-themed vacations. Visitors can explore a variety of attractions, including churches, cathedrals, and national parks, which provide rich cultural experiences and stunning outdoor scenery. Whether you seek a taste of local heritage or the beauty of nature, Bulacan caters to diverse interests, making it a delightful location for all types of travellers.

  • Malolos Cathedral: This historic cathedral, located in the heart of Bulacan, showcases stunning architecture and rich cultural heritage. Its serene atmosphere invites reflection and appreciation of its intricate details, making it a significant spiritual and cultural landmark.
  • Barasoain Church: Known as the birthplace of the First Philippine Republic, Barasoain Church is a beautiful structure steeped in history. Its grand façade and historical significance offer visitors a glimpse into the nation’s past, creating a profound connection to Filipino heritage.
  • Biak na Bato National Park: An outdoor haven, this national park features breathtaking scenery with limestone formations and lush vegetation. Adventure seekers can enjoy hiking trails that reveal the park’s natural beauty, along with opportunities for exploration and wildlife sightings.

When is the best time to go to Bulacan?
That depends on what you want from your Bulacan break. If you want to visit in summer, which is between June and August, expect average temperatures of between 25ºC and 31ºC. Bulacan has a tropical rainforest climate, so keep that in mind when you pack.
